Stata is agile, easy to use, and fast, with the ability to load and process up to 120,000 variables and over 20 billion observations. In this course, take a deeper dive into the popular statistics software. Instructor Franz Buscha explores advanced and specialized topics in Stata, from panel data modeling to interaction effects in regression models. Franz demonstrates several sophisticated data management functions and visualization techniques to complement the basic Stata operations that you may have already mastered. Plus learn about Monte Carlo simulations, count data analysis, survival analysis, and more.

Topics include:

  • Formatting the display of variables
  • Repeating commands by looping
  • Visualization techniques, including drawing custom functions
  • Interaction effects in regression models
  • Panel data modeling
  • Random numbers and simulation methods
  • Count data modeling
  • Survival analysis
